Course Details

Global E-commerce Privacy Regulations: An overview of the major privacy laws and regulations that impact global e-commerce, including GDPR, CCPA, and others.
Privacy Policies & Terms of Service: Best practices for creating clear, concise, and compliant privacy policies and terms of service for e-commerce businesses.
Data Security & Encryption: Strategies for protecting customer data, including data encryption, secure payment processing, and other security measures.
Data Collection & Analytics: Understanding the legal and ethical considerations around collecting and analyzing customer data in e-commerce, including cookie policies and opt-in/opt-out options.
Cross-Border Data Transfers: Regulations and best practices for transferring customer data across international borders, including data localization laws.
Data Breach Response Planning: Developing a comprehensive plan for responding to data breaches, including notification requirements and communication strategies.
E-commerce Privacy & AI: Examining the unique privacy challenges posed by artificial intelligence and machine learning in e-commerce, including facial recognition and other biometric data.
The Future of Data in E-commerce: Exploring emerging trends and technologies in e-commerce data, including privacy-preserving data sharing, differential privacy, and other innovative approaches to data protection.
